Verse (49:3), Word 6 - Quranic Grammar

__

The sixth word of verse (49:3) is a masculine noun and is in the genitive case (مجرور). The noun's triliteral root is rā sīn lām (ر س ل).

Chapter (49) sūrat l-ḥujurāt (The Dwellings)


(49:3:6)
rasūli
(of the) Messenger of Allah -
N – genitive masculine noun اسم مجرور

Verse (49:3)

The analysis above refers to the third verse of chapter 49 (sūrat l-ḥujurāt):

Sahih International: Indeed, those who lower their voices before the Messenger of Allah - they are the ones whose hearts Allah has tested for righteousness. For them is forgiveness and great reward.
